Visit Devils Tower - America's first national monument. It is the core of an ancient volcano rising above the rolling Wyoming plains. A visual oddity surrounded by Indian legend and a diverse wildlife population. The rolling hills of this 1,347 acre park are covered with pine forests, deciduous woodlands, and prairie grass. Deer, prairie dogs, and other wildlife are abundant.

When you visit Yellowstone, you experience a world like no other. A visual playground with bubbling hot springs, thunderous waterfalls, fascinating wildlife and steaming geysers. Everywhere you look, you will be enthralled with the natural wonders, such as Old Faithful; Grand Canyon of the Yellowstone and Upper and Lower Falls.
